    Pectins from Herbstreith & Fox

    The natural product pectin is an important

    structural element of all higher plants. It is

    mainly produced from apples, citrus fruits and

    sugar beets. As an universally applicable gelling

    and thickening agent pectin today is an especi-

    ally important, indispensable and additionally

    healthy ingredient of many products.

    Due to its natural origin and versatile product

    parameters pectin is contained in many pro-

    ducts, often without the consumer realising that

    it is there.

    8 De-pectinised pomace /peels

    After the extraction of the pectin thede-pectinised raw material is driedand pelletised.

    3 DryingSince apples and citrus fruits areonly harvested during a fewweeks in the year and pectin is

    being produced throughout theyear, the gentle and careful dry-ing of the fruit residues is impor-tant. Only carefully and gentlydried apple pomace and citruspeels can be stored for a longperiod of time.

    4 Apple pomace /citrus peels

    These are the terms used forthe fruit residues which resultfrom the production of fruitjuices and fruit wines.Pomace and citrus peels arethe raw materials for thepectin production.

    5 StorageThe dried pomace or peels arebrought from the juice produ-cer to the pectin producer.There they are stored in specialstorage halls under constantcontrol and are processedthroughout the year.

    1a Apple harvestAt harvest time, largequantities of differenttypes of apples areharvested.

    1b Citrus harvestThe raw material for ourCitrus Pectins comes main-ly from Argentina, Mexicoand Southern Europe.

    2 PressingThe fruits are broughtfrom the apple and citrusplantations to the juiceproducers. There the fruitsare pressed and processedto apple juice resp. citrusjuice and citrus oil.

    10a ExtractsThe apple extract is purified and usedas fresh-keeping and colouring fruitsweeteners Herbasweet and Herbarom.

    6 ExtractionThe insoluble proto-pectin ofthe cell walls is extracted assoluble pectin.

    7 Cleaning thepectin extract

    The pectin extract mustbe cleaned. Mechanicalcleaning processes like

    filtration etc. will separa-te the insoluble compo-nents from the extract.

    8a Cattle feedsDe-pectinised applepomace and citrus peelsare used as cattle feedHerbavital.

    9 PrecipitationPectin is insoluble in alcohol. Thisfact is used for precipitation. In aspecial process using alcohol thepectin is separated from itsaqueous solution and washed.

    10 DistillationThe alcoholic extract is distilledand the pure alcohol is returnedto the precipitation cycle. Fruitsugars and colours are obtained

    as fruit extract.

    15 StorageDuring the detailed laboratory teststhe pectin is temporarily stored.

    16 Laboratory tests /Standardisation

    The pectin is examined and putthrough various tests. Here the recipewill be determined for standardisati-on. Not each pectin is suitable forevery kind of application as differentproducts need pectin with differentgelling or thickening properties.

    17 Packing and deliveryAfter the pectin has passed all stagesof the production process, it issuitably packed and deliveredto the various industrialconsumers to become animportant ingredientof many foods,cosmetic andpharmaceuticalproducts.

    Pectin is animportant elementof many food and luxuryproducts, cosmetics andpharmaceuticals.
